Chelsea to make improved bid for Asmir Begovic
Chelsea will come up with a new offer for Asmir Begovic having seen their initial bid of £6m rebuffed by Stoke City.
The Blues boss Jose Mourinho is keen on signing up the Bosnian international as a replacement for Petr Cech, who left the Premier League holders for Arsenal recently.
According to The Telegraph, the West London giants will make a fresh offer in the region of £8m for the talented shot-stopper.
Begovic is believed to be keen on a move to Stamford Bridge even if he would have to play as an understudy to Thibaut Courtois next season.
